The Silent Witness: Poison Detection in Forensic Toxicology
In the realm of criminal investigations, poisons often hide themselves as invisible offenders. Forensic toxicologists act as silent witnesses, meticulously analyzing biological samples to uncover the presence of these lethal substances. Their expertise plays a essential role in solving complex incidents. Through a spectrum of sophisticated techniques, forensic toxicologists can determine the type of poison, its level, and the manner in which it was administered. These results provide invaluable clues to investigators, helping them construct a compelling case against the perpetrator.
The forensic toxicology laboratory is a wellspring of scientific tools and expertise. Skilled technicians utilize advanced apparatus to analyze blood, urine, tissue samples, and even hair. These analyses can reveal the detection of a wide array of poisons, from common household cleaners to potent toxins.
